This testing involves crushing panels and exposing fragments to acidic solvents, yet the materials consistently fail to leach above hazardous levels. . Solar panels use few hazardous materials to begin with. When used, these materials come in very small quantities, and they are sealed in high-strength encapsulants that prevent chemical leaching, even when solar panels have been crushed or exposed to extreme heat or rainwater. As demand for renewable. . The generation of electricity from photovoltaic (PV) solar panels is safe and effective. Because PV systems do not burn fossil fuels they do not produce the toxic air or greenhouse gas emissions associated with conventional fossil fuel fired generation technologies.

Employment of solar photovoltaic installers is projected to grow 42 percent from 2024 to 2034, much faster than the average for all occupations. Solar Photovoltaic Installers made a median salary of $51,860 in 2024. The best-paid 25% made $63,020 that year, while the lowest-paid 25% made $46,040.
